The New York Public Library has computerized book (and music, and video) checkout and return.
I hadn't realized until I looked at the slip on the CD I borrowed a few days ago what a useful thing they're doing. It doesn't just tell me that this item is due on thus-and-such date. It lists everything I currently have out with the due dates. This is particularly useful because I'd forgotten that I have a book due on the 29th. Returning it on time will be trivial, now that I've been reminded.
(The system also knows that I owe them 50¢, and the next time I go there, with any luck there will be a functioning cash register and we can clear this up. But the book in question is not listed as still checked out, so that's okay.)
